Hi All

I'm loving the new Outlook, however I'm having real difficulty manually sorting my email folders.

Clicking & dragging the folder, only allows me to drop the folder INTO another folder, but doesn't allow me to drop it in between other folders (meaning I cannot re-arrange / sort the folders manually).

Right clicking the folder and clicking "Move", again only allows me to move the folder INTO another folder. There is no "move up or down" option unfortunately.

It is currently sorting my folders in alphabetical order, but I wish to change this. I have been through all the settings and cannot find anywhere I can manually sort my email folders.

Can anyone assist?

    2023-11-09T15:06:08+00:00

    I found a work around but I am not sure if you would like it. If you put a number before the name, it will move them up or down on the list.

    01 Important

    04 IT Department

    02 HR Department

    In the following example it will put HR a head of IT, it works good for me just thought I would offer this up.
